To avoid anyone thinking that calcium or sodium is the cause of their stress, I just want to say that the cell biology you're reading about is about voltage-gated calcium channels, not about relative amounts of calcium in the bloodstream or interstitial fluid. Rather, calcium is used as a messenger to activate processes on the other side of the membrane. In the adrenal medulla, the primary messenger is an axonal depolarization.
In general, there's usually something very pathological going on for calcium to become dysregulated in the bloodstream, such as cancer, hyperparathyroidism, hypervitaminosis D, or hyperphosphatemia.
